You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@datalab.apache.org by dg...@apache.org on 2020/12/02 09:13:49 UTC
[incubator-datalab] branch gh-pages updated: Correcting text in
community page, fixed animation
This is an automated email from the ASF dual-hosted git repository.
dgnatyshyn pushed a commit to branch gh-pages
in repository https://gitbox.apache.org/repos/asf/incubator-datalab.git
The following commit(s) were added to refs/heads/gh-pages by this push:
new 6825c83 Correcting text in community page, fixed animation
6825c83 is described below
commit 6825c83525bcc6a4b9f79b88b7208828e2d534ec
Author: Dmytro_Gnatyshyn <di...@ukr.net>
AuthorDate: Wed Dec 2 11:13:34 2020 +0200
Correcting text in community page, fixed animation
---
dist/main.js | 2 +-
index.html | 95 +++++++++++++++++++++++++++-------------------------
src/js/init.js | 8 ++---
src/style/style.scss | 29 ++++++++++++----
4 files changed, 77 insertions(+), 57 deletions(-)
diff --git a/dist/main.js b/dist/main.js
index bbbf7d6..073d02d 100644
--- a/dist/main.js
+++ b/dist/main.js
@@ -26,4 +26,4 @@ function(e){var t,n,i,a,r,s,o,l,d,p,c,u,f,m,h,g,v,b,w,y="sizzle"+1*new Date,x=e.
/*! lozad.js - v1.14.0 - 2019-10-19
* https://github.com/ApoorvSaxena/lozad.js
* Copyright (c) 2019 Apoorv Saxena; Licensed MIT */
-e.exports=function(){"use strict";var e="undefined"!=typeof document&&document.documentMode,t={rootMargin:"0px",threshold:0,load:function(t){if("picture"===t.nodeName.toLowerCase()){var n=document.createElement("img");e&&t.getAttribute("data-iesrc")&&(n.src=t.getAttribute("data-iesrc")),t.getAttribute("data-alt")&&(n.alt=t.getAttribute("data-alt")),t.append(n)}if("video"===t.nodeName.toLowerCase()&&!t.getAttribute("data-src")&&t.children){for(var i=t.children,a=void 0,r=0;r<=i.length-1;r [...]
\ No newline at end of file
+e.exports=function(){"use strict";var e="undefined"!=typeof document&&document.documentMode,t={rootMargin:"0px",threshold:0,load:function(t){if("picture"===t.nodeName.toLowerCase()){var n=document.createElement("img");e&&t.getAttribute("data-iesrc")&&(n.src=t.getAttribute("data-iesrc")),t.getAttribute("data-alt")&&(n.alt=t.getAttribute("data-alt")),t.append(n)}if("video"===t.nodeName.toLowerCase()&&!t.getAttribute("data-src")&&t.children){for(var i=t.children,a=void 0,r=0;r<=i.length-1;r [...]
\ No newline at end of file
diff --git a/index.html b/index.html
index 5ce7891..d33038f 100755
--- a/index.html
+++ b/index.html
@@ -1065,61 +1065,64 @@
<div id="community" class="overlay">
<div class="overlay-wrap" style="display: none">
- <div class="row content-desc">
- <a class="close-butt-download">×</a>
- <h2>Apache DataLab Community</h2>
- <h3>How We Communicate</h3>
- <p>There are many ways that are available for our community to communicate with each other and directly with our developers. Please review the following for methods that meet your needs.</p>
+ <div class="row content-desc scrolling">
+ <div class="contant-wrapper">
+ <a class="close-butt-download">×</a>
+ <h2>Apache DataLab Community</h2>
+ <h3>How We Communicate</h3>
+ <p>There are many ways that are available for our community to communicate with each other and directly with our developers. Please review the following methods that meet your needs.</p>
- <h4>Mailing List</h4>
- <p>Mailing list is where we discuss in public and keep everything tracked. You are welcomed to subscribe it if you wish:</p>
+ <h4>Mailing List</h4>
+ <p>Mailing list is where we discuss in public and keep everything tracked. You are welcomed to subscribe it if you wish:</p>
- <ul class="subscribe-list">
- <li class="subscribe-list-item">To be informed about bug reports or feature requests;</li>
- <li class="subscribe-list-item">To discuss about developing plans or specific issues;</li>
- <li class="subscribe-list-item">To discuss about developing plans or specific issues;</li>
- <li class="subscribe-list-item">To offer helps to those who ask questions by email;</li>
- </ul>
- <p>If you have a specific bug to report or feature request, we'd suggest you opening an issue with our issue helper tool, which is a more efficient way to report the details.</p>
- <p><a href="mailto:commits@datalab.incubator.apache.org">commits@datalab.incubator.apache.org</a> focuses on the commit logs, while
- <a href="mailto:dev@datalab.incubator.apache.org">dev@datalab.incubator.apache.org</a> holds other general discussions.
- </p>
- <p>These two are public mailing list, and you can get access to them on Website
- <a href="https://lists.apache.org/list.html?commits@datalab.apache.org" target="_blank">https://lists.apache.org/list.html?commits@datalab.apache.org</a> and
- <a href="https://lists.apache.org/list.html?dev@datalab.apache.org">https://lists.apache.org/list.html?dev@datalab.apache.org</a> and without subscribing.
- </p>
+ <ul class="subscribe-list">
+ <li class="subscribe-list-item">To be informed about bug reports or feature requests;</li>
+ <li class="subscribe-list-item">To discuss developing plans or specific issues;</li>
+ <li class="subscribe-list-item">To offer helps to those who ask questions by email;</li>
+ </ul>
+ <p>If you have a specific bug to report or a feature request, we suggest opening an issue with our helper tool, which is much more efficient way to report the details:</p>
+ <p>
+ <ul class="subscribe-list">
+ <li class="subscribe-list-item"><a href="mailto:commits@datalab.incubator.apache.org">commits@datalab.incubator.apache.org</a> focuses on the commit logs;</li>
+ <li class="subscribe-list-item"><a href="mailto:dev@datalab.incubator.apache.org">dev@datalab.incubator.apache.org</a> holds other general discussions;</li>
+ <p>These two channels are public mailing list, and you can get access to them on Website
+ <a href="https://lists.apache.org/list.html?commits@datalab.apache.org" target="_blank">https://lists.apache.org/list.html?commits@datalab.apache.org</a> and
+ <a href="https://lists.apache.org/list.html?dev@datalab.apache.org">https://lists.apache.org/list.html?dev@datalab.apache.org</a> and without subscribing.
+ </p>
- <h4>User Comunication</h4>
- <p>Githab issue: <a href="https://github.com/apache/incubator-datalab/issues" target="_blank">https://github.com/apache/incubator-datalab/issues</a></p>
- <p>Youtube channel: <a href="https://www.youtube.com/DataLabCommunity" target="_blank">https://www.youtube.com/DataLabCommunity</a></p>
- <p>Twitter: <a href="https://twitter.com/GroupDataLab">https://twitter.com/GroupDataLab</a></p>
+ <h4>User Comunication</h4>
+ <p>Githab issue: <a href="https://github.com/apache/incubator-datalab/issues" target="_blank">https://github.com/apache/incubator-datalab/issues</a></p>
+ <p>Bug tracking system: <a href="https://issues.apache.org/jira/issues/?jql=project%20%3D%20DATALAB" target="_blank">https://issues.apache.org/jira/issues</a></p>
+ <p>Youtube channel: <a href="https://www.youtube.com/DataLabCommunity" target="_blank">https://www.youtube.com/DataLabCommunity</a></p>
+ <p>Twitter: <a href="https://twitter.com/GroupDataLab">https://twitter.com/GroupDataLab</a></p>
- <h3>Contributing</h3>
- <p>We are always open to contributions from our community. Contributions can be of many forms: documentation, testing, science as well as bug fixes, code enhancements, code reviews, feature suggestions, usability feedback, etc. Contributions usually take the form of a Pull Request (PR), but if you wish to contribute and not sure how, please contact us on our dev list.</p>
+ <h3>Contributing</h3>
+ <p>We are always open to contributions from our community. Contributions can be of many forms: documentation, testing, science as well as bug fixes, code enhancements, code reviews, feature suggestions, usability feedback, so forth. Contributions usually take the form of a Pull Request (PR), but if you wish to contribute and not sure how, please contact us via our dev list.</p>
- <h4>Getting your proposed changes accepted</h4>
- <p>Proposed changes to the code or documentation are usually done through GitHub Pull Requests (PRs).</p>
- <ul class="subscribe-list">
- <li class="subscribe-list-item">Simple PRs, such as simple bug fixes, typos, and documentation corrections require one approval vote (+1) from a committer.</li>
- <li class="subscribe-list-item">Major changes to the code such as API or architectural changes must be discussed on dev or on a GitHub issue as these will require additional design and compatibility reviews. These changes must receive at least three (+1) votes from committers. If the author is already a committer, than two additional committers must vote (+1).</li>
- </ul>
- <h4>Becoming a committer</h4>
+ <h4>Getting your proposed changes accepted</h4>
+ <p>Proposed changes to the code or documentation are usually done through GitHub Pull Requests (PRs).</p>
+ <ul class="subscribe-list">
+ <li class="subscribe-list-item">Simple PRs, such as simple bug fixes, typos, and documentation corrections require one approval from a committer.</li>
+ <li class="subscribe-list-item">Major changes to the code such as API or architectural changes must be discussed on dev or on a GitHub issue as these will require additional design and compatibility reviews.</li>
+ </ul>
+ <h4>Becoming a committer</h4>
- <p> We welcome anyone who is eager to continue to contribute to the DataLab mission of providing open source and become part of our team. Please send us a message on dev where we can give you some guidance. After you have made some successful contributions, the current committers will discuss your candidacy for becoming a committer. You can also review the Apache policies on becoming a committer as well as our New Committer Process for selecting and inviting a committer to [...]
+ <p> We welcome anyone who is eager to continue to contribute to the DataLab mission of providing open source and become a part of our team. Please send us a message via dev where we can give you some guidance. After you have made some successful contributions, the current committers will discuss your candidacy for becoming a committer. You can also review the Apache policies on becoming a committer as well as our New Committer Process for selecting and inviting a commi [...]
- <h3>Reporting Security Issues</h3>
- <p>If you wish to report a security vulnerability, please contact security@apache.org. Apache DataLab follows the typical Apache vulnerability handling process.</p>
+ <h3>Reporting Security Issues</h3>
+ <p>If you wish to report a security vulnerability, please contact <a href="mailto:security@apache.org">security@apache.org</a>. Apache DataLab follows the typical Apache vulnerability handling process.</p>
- <h4>Governance</h4>
- <p>The Project Management Committee (PMC) is responsible for the administrative aspects of the DataLab project.</p>
+ <h4>Governance</h4>
+ <p>The Project Management Committee (PMC) is responsible for the administrative aspects of the DataLab project.</p>
- <p>The basic responsibilities of the PMC include:</p>
- <ul class="subscribe-list">
- <li class="subscribe-list-item">Approving releases</li>
- <li class="subscribe-list-item">Nominating new committers</li>
- <li class="subscribe-list-item">Maintaining the project’s shared resources, including the github account, mailing lists, websites, social media channels, etc.</li>
- <li class="subscribe-list-item">Maintaining guidelines for the project</li>
- </ul>
+ <p>The basic responsibilities of the PMC include:</p>
+ <ul class="subscribe-list">
+ <li class="subscribe-list-item">Approving releases</li>
+ <li class="subscribe-list-item">Nominating new committers</li>
+ <li class="subscribe-list-item">Maintaining the project’s shared resources, including the github account, mailing lists, websites, social media channels, etc.</li>
+ <li class="subscribe-list-item">Maintaining guidelines for the project</li>
+ </ul>
+ </div>
</div>
<div class="contact-wrapper">
<div class="contact-us">
diff --git a/src/js/init.js b/src/js/init.js
index 6fd84ce..e6ab73f 100644
--- a/src/js/init.js
+++ b/src/js/init.js
@@ -208,8 +208,8 @@ $( window ).on( 'hashchange', function( e ) {
'left': '-1px',
'opacity': 0,
});
- $('.contact-us').css({
- 'position': "unset"
+ $('.contant-wrapper').css({
+ 'display': "none"
});
}
} );
@@ -225,7 +225,7 @@ function showDownloadPage(hash){
display: "flex"
});
if(hash === '#community')
- $('.contact-us').css({
- 'position': "fixed"
+ $('.contant-wrapper').css({
+ 'display': "block"
});
}
diff --git a/src/style/style.scss b/src/style/style.scss
index d45b4bc..04a4bcd 100755
--- a/src/style/style.scss
+++ b/src/style/style.scss
@@ -1847,6 +1847,9 @@ footer {
text-align: left;
padding: 1rem 2rem;
margin: 0;
+ overflow: auto;
+ height: 100vh;
+ scrollbar-width: thin;
a:not(.close-butt-download){
display: inline;
font-size: 15px;
@@ -1885,12 +1888,6 @@ footer {
}
.contact-wrapper{
width: 50%;
-
- .contact-us{
- width: 50%;
- position: fixed;
- right: 0;
- }
}
}
@@ -1914,3 +1911,23 @@ footer {
}
}
+.scrolling::-webkit-scrollbar {
+ width: 5px;
+ height: 5px;
+}
+
+.scrolling::-webkit-scrollbar-track {
+ box-shadow: none;
+ -webkit-box-shadow: none;
+ background-color: rgb(243, 243, 243);
+}
+
+.scrolling::-webkit-scrollbar-thumb {
+ background-color: #f6fafe;
+ background-color: rgba(0, 0, 0, 0.4);
+}
+
+.contant-wrapper{
+ transition: 5s;
+}
+
---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@datalab.apache.org
For additional commands, e-mail: commits-help@datalab.apache.org